+        # The following are arrays of 36 linked lists: the linked lists
+        # at indices 1 to 35 correspond to pages that store objects of
+        # size  1 * WORD  to  35 * WORD,  and the linked list at index 0
+        # is a list of all larger objects.
         def list_of_addresses_per_small_size():
             return lltype.malloc(rffi.CArray(llmemory.Address),
                                  self.pagelists_length, flavor='raw',
                                  zero=True, immortal=True)
+        # 1-35: a linked list of all pages; 0: a linked list of all larger objs
         self.nonfree_pages = list_of_addresses_per_small_size()
+        # a snapshot of 'nonfree_pages' done when the collection starts
         self.collect_pages = list_of_addresses_per_small_size()
+        # 1-35: free list of non-allocated locations; 0: unused
         self.free_lists    = list_of_addresses_per_small_size()
+        # 1-35: head and tail of the free list built by the collector thread
         self.collect_heads = list_of_addresses_per_small_size()
         self.collect_tails = list_of_addresses_per_small_size()
+        #
+        # The following character is either MARK_VALUE_1 or MARK_VALUE_2,
+        # and represents the character that must be in the 'mark' field
+        # of an object header in order for the object to be considered as
+        # marked.  Objects whose 'mark' field have the opposite value are
+        # not marked yet; the collector thread will mark them if they are
+        # still alive, or sweep them away if they are not reachable.
+        # The special value MARK_VALUE_STATIC is initially used in the
+        # 'mark' field of static prebuilt GC objects.
         self.current_mark = MARK_VALUE_1
